In the Smoky Hills district of Central Kansas, located just South of state route 140, you will find Mushroom Rock State Park. The park's name comes from the famous mushroom rock formations, although the park has several other unique rock formations. The park comprises only five acres, but it still has a lot to offer. Mushroom Rock State Park is a unique geological formation located in Kansas, USA. This park features several interesting rock formations, including mushroom-shaped rocks that have been sculpted by erosion over the years. Mushroom Rock State Park was formed over 144 to 66 million years ago, during the Cretaceous Period, and is home to some of the most unusual rock formations anywhere. The park’s iconic Dakota formations, which resemble giant mushrooms rising above the horizon, are the result of sedimentary rock and sandstone held together ... Mushroom Rock State Park is noted for its mushroom rock formations. It is located in the Smoky Hills region of north-central Kansas in Ellsworth County, Kansas, United States. These rocks are the remains of beach sands and sediments of the Cretaceous Period, the interval of geologic time from about 144 to 66 million years ago.
